International Languages Week is now well established in New Zealand communities and schools, with many doing creative, entertaining things to get across the importance for New Zealanders of learning international languages. 

In 2008 we plan to take International Languages Week to the furthest corners of Aotearoa New Zealand with school based activities and celebrations reaching out into the the wider community from the Far North to the Deep South. Exciting things are happening in schools as the initiative to offer languages other than English in all schools with Year 7, 8, 9 or 10 classes gathers momentum. International Languages Week offers the ideal opportunity to showcase these developments and to inform and inspire the wider community.

 

Everyone can participate in the Greetings Project (Ni hao! on Monday, Bonjour! on Tuesday, Guten Tag! on Wednesday, Konnichiwa! on Thursday and Buenos días! on Friday), and perhaps speakers of other languages could teach people further greetings.
